KOKOaja
KOKOaja is a tool for combining an upper general ontology and a number of domain ontologies, all in SKOS-format, into a single whole. It builds a new set of concepts based on those found in the ontologies combining matching concepts into one taking care to assign always the same URI to the same concepts.
The main intended use for KOKOaja is in building the Finnish Collaborative Holistic Ontology KOKO.
